Shijiazhuang, Hebei: Migratory Birds Nesting in Hutuo River Scenic Area
A flock of black-necked gulls are nesting in the Hutuo River Scenic Area in Shijiazhuang, Hebei. Photo by reporter Tian Rui of Hebei Daily.

On March 1st, a group of migratory birds were nesting in the Hutuo River Scenic Area in Shijiazhuang, Hebei.
Recently, the Shijiazhuang section of the Hutuo River Scenic Area welcomed more than 20 species of migratory birds, totaling thousands, including black-necked gulls, black-billed ducks, white spoonbills, and common shovel-beaked ducks. Among them, white spoonbills, black-billed ducks, and white spoonbills are rare bird species. Photo by reporter Tian Rui of Hebei Daily.
